Wire Gauge Selection
After confirming the connector pinout, you’ll need to pick the right wire gauge for the 25-pin harness to protect circuits and guarantee reliable operation. You’ll typically choose 18 to 14 AWG for automotive use; remember AWG numbers drop as wire gets thicker, so lower numbers carry more current. Check each circuit’s load so the gauge meets or exceeds the required current and prevents overheating. Proper gauge minimizes voltage drop, preserving performance for sensors, lights, and motors. Don’t use undersized wires—higher resistance can reduce component function and create fire risk. If a run is long or feeds high-draw devices, err toward thicker wire. Match gauge choices to actual load calculations rather than guesswork.

Corrosion and Weatherproofing
Although your CTS spends most of its life exposed to moisture, road salt, and temperature swings, you can greatly extend harness life by choosing corrosion-resistant materials and proper seals. Pick harnesses with copper conductors that have protective plating or coatings to keep conductivity high and slow metal degradation. Look for PVC or thermoplastic insulation and fully sealed connectors to block rain, snow, and road spray. When you install a harness, use heat-shrink tubing over splices and apply dielectric grease inside connectors to prevent moisture ingress and corrosion. Finally, inspect harnesses regularly for chafing, cracked insulation, or greenish corrosion on terminals; addressing issues early preserves reliability and safety and avoids costly electrical failures down the road.
